    Douay Rheims Bible

    Woe to you who build the monuments of the prophets: and your fathers killed them.

    King James Bible - Luke 11:47

    Woe unto you! for ye build the sepulchres of the prophets, and your fathers killed them.

    World English Bible

    Woe to you! For you build the tombs of the prophets, and your fathers killed them.
